Description | BBC Constituency Profile:
Located to the south of Liverpool is the seat of Garston and Halewood. A socially diverse constituency, it combines well-heeled residential areas such as Allerton and Woolton - the childhood home of John Lennon - with large ex-council estates like Speke.
The seat is bounded by the River Mersey, the M62 and Green Belt land beyond Halewood. Garston is a major shipping and container port, while Halewood is home to the Land Rover Assembly plant. One in four of the population lives in social housing; one in 20 has never worked, according to ONS 2011 Census figures for England and Wales. At 76.5%, it has the 13th highest proportion of people describing themselves as Christian. One in four works in retail and manufacturing.
A Labour seat since 1983, the party's Maria Eagle held the seat in 2010 with 59.5% of the votes; Liberal Democrats got 20.1%, Conservative 16.1% and UKIP 3.6%. |
